The dna strand that is replicated in discontinuous segments is known as the strand

The DNA strand that is duplicated from a template strand in the 3' to 5' orientation is known as the lagging strand. It is produced in pieces.

The "leading strand" and "lagging strand" are terms used to describe the DNA strands that are continually and intermittently produced, respectively. "Okazaki fragments" are the short, lagging strand pieces.

<h3>What does the phrase "discontinuous DNA replication" mean?</h3>

intermittent replication the process of creating a new strand of a DNA molecule that is capable of replication out of a number of little pieces that are later connected. This method is only used to synthesis one of the new strands, the so-called lagging strand.
